[PATCH 007/193] arch/arm: remove CONFIG_EXPERIMENTAL

From: Kees Cook
Date: Tue Oct 23 2012 - 16:59:46 EST


This config item has not carried much meaning for a while now and is
almost always enabled by default. As agreed during the Linux kernel
summit, remove it.
